I've been seriously considering buying an older firetruck, and pulling off or modifying the fire-bed to use as a tractor-hauler... anyone else done this?


Posted By: Greg (Hillsboro, OH)
Date Posted: 14 Jun 2010 at 6:18am
remember when buying a fire truck, they are usually very low miles, but HIGH engine hours.  They sit a lot of hours running at full loads for the pumps.
